Artswork Limited in Ashford is seeking candidates for a 6-month employability programme aimed at gaining workplace experience in the Creative Industry. The role involves planning and delivering Creative Learning programmes, providing administrative support, and assisting with marketing communications.

Ideal candidates will have dance experience, along with strong organizational and communication skills, contributing to both the Creative Learning and Marketing teams. This opportunity is perfect for anyone looking to begin their career in a dynamic and artistic environ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Artswork Limited

Show Off Your Creative Side

For a marketing communications trainee role, it's crucial to demonstrate your creativity. Think of ways you can present your ideas or previous projects, maybe even tailoring a mini-campaign to showcase your skills. Use visuals in your portfolio that reflect your creative thought process—style is key here!

Brush Up on Digital Tools

Get familiar with industry-standard tools like Google Analytics, HubSpot, or Canva. These are often discussed in interviews for marketing roles, so having a few examples up your sleeve where you've used them (even in a project or assignment) will definitely impress the hiring team at Artswork Limited.

Prepare for Real-Life Scenarios

In your interview, they might ask you to brainstorm ideas for a campaign or tackle a problem they’re facing. Practise answering these types of questions by studying case studies or real-world campaigns, and think about what you’d do differently if given the chance. This shows your ability to think on your feet!

Highlight Your Willingness to Learn

As this is a trainee position, showing your eagerness to learn and grow is more important than having extensive experience. Talk about what excites you about the marketing world and how you adapt when faced with new challenges. Employers at Artswork Limited love to see enthusiasm and a growth mindset!
